Fidelity National Information Services (FIS) Debt to Equity: 2009-2024
Historic Debt to Equity for Fidelity National Information Services (FIS) over the last 16 years, with Dec 2024 value amounting to $0.68.
- Fidelity National Information Services' Debt to Equity rose 21.39% to $0.79 in Q3 2025 from the same period last year, while for Sep 2025 it was $0.79, marking a year-over-year increase of 21.39%. This contributed to the annual value of $0.68 for FY2024, which is 27.06% down from last year.
- As of FY2024, Fidelity National Information Services' Debt to Equity stood at $0.68, which was down 27.06% from $0.93 recorded in FY2023.
- In the past 5 years, Fidelity National Information Services' Debt to Equity registered a high of $0.93 during FY2023, and its lowest value of $0.38 during FY2020.
- Over the past 3 years, Fidelity National Information Services' median Debt to Equity value was $0.68 (recorded in 2024), while the average stood at $0.76.
- In the last 5 years, Fidelity National Information Services' Debt to Equity soared by 66.75% in 2022 and then declined by 27.06% in 2024.
- Over the past 5 years, Fidelity National Information Services' Debt to Equity (Yearly) stood at $0.38 in 2020, then grew by 4.32% to $0.40 in 2021, then surged by 66.75% to $0.66 in 2022, then spiked by 41.04% to $0.93 in 2023, then dropped by 27.06% to $0.68 in 2024.
